In the tapestry of life, relationships weave a rich and intricate design. To truly thrive, we must cultivate connections that are built on a foundation of compassion. This involves actively listening to others, resonating with their experiences, and offering support. When we approach relationships with kindness and consideration, we create a space here where both parties can grow.
- Acknowledge that every individual is on their own unique journey.
- Engage in empathy by putting yourself in another's shoes.
- Express your feelings honestly and openly.
By embracing these principles, we can forge connections that are not only valuable but also provide a source of strength and happiness in our lives.
Healing Through Forgiveness: Letting Go of Resentment and Embracing Peace
Forgiveness represents a powerful journey that allows us to release the shackles of resentment and discover a state of inner peace. It's not about condoning harmful actions but rather choosing liberation for ourselves. By letting go of anger and bitterness, we create the possibility for compassion to flourish, both within us and in our relationships. This process requires courage and a willingness to confront painful emotions, but the rewards are immeasurable. It's through forgiveness that we cultivate a deeper sense of harmony and allow ourselves to truly thrive.
Unveiling Your Inner Worth: Boosting Self-Esteem and Releasing Guilt
Self-esteem is a fundamental aspect of our well-being that profoundly impacts how we perceive ourselves and the world around us. Cultivating a strong sense of self-worth can empower us to embrace opportunities with confidence and navigate difficulties with resilience.
When our self-esteem is shaky, we may fall into negative thought patterns and feelings of doubt. This can lead to a cycle of putting ourselves down and limit our ability to fully be ourselves. Releasing guilt, which often stems from perceived failures, is also crucial for embracing self-love and acceptance.
By practicing self-compassion, setting realistic boundaries, and celebrating our strengths, we can begin to heal our inner self.
